Comprehensive Course Details & Information

• Evolutionary Algorithms: Fundamentals and Advanced Topics
• Genetic Programming: Theory and Applications
• Evolutionary Strategies and Differential Evolution
• Multi-Objective Optimization using Evolutionary Computation
• Evolutionary Robotics and Artificial Life
• Machine Learning and Evolutionary Computation
• Applications of Evolutionary Computing in Bioinformatics
• Advanced Topics in Evolutionary Computation: Co-evolution and Niche Formation

Career Opportunities

Career Role Description
Evolutionary Algorithm Engineer (Primary: Evolutionary Algorithm, Secondary: AI) Develops and implements cutting-edge evolutionary algorithms for diverse applications in industries such as finance and healthcare. High demand for expertise in genetic algorithms and optimization.
Machine Learning Engineer (Evolutionary Computing) (Primary: Machine Learning, Secondary: Evolutionary Computing) Applies evolutionary computing techniques to improve machine learning models, focusing on hyperparameter optimization and model selection. Strong analytical and programming skills are essential.
Data Scientist (Evolutionary Optimization) (Primary: Data Science, Secondary: Evolutionary Optimization) Utilizes evolutionary optimization algorithms to solve complex data-driven problems in various sectors. Requires proficiency in statistical analysis and data visualization.
Bioinformatics Scientist (Evolutionary Algorithms) (Primary: Bioinformatics, Secondary: Evolutionary Algorithms) Applies evolutionary algorithms to analyze biological data, such as genomic sequences. Deep understanding of biology and computational techniques is needed.
